LD, it's pretty hoppy but that's appropriate for the style. It has a lot of differnt hops in it but the total IBUs is around 40 so it's not crazy hoppy. Here's the hop schedule:
4 HBUs Cascade - 90 min.
2 HBUs Mt. Hood - 90 min.
0.5 oz. Tettnanger - 15 min.
0.5 oz. Fuggles - 10 min.
0.5 oz. Fuggles - 1 min.
0.5 oz. Cascade - dry

Ever heard of a beer made by Hair of the Dog Brewing Co. called Fred? It has 10 different kinds of hops in it in 4 additions.
